我有一個datagridview並需要上下文菜單。 當我右鍵單擊單元格(紅點) - 上下文菜單顯示.. 但錯誤的地方。 不明白爲什麼 這裏是代碼:上下文菜單錯誤出現位置
ContextMenu m = new ContextMenu();
m.Show(ServersTable, new Point(Cursor.Position.X, Cursor.Position.Y));
的東西真的惹惱了我!
我有一個datagridview並需要上下文菜單。 當我右鍵單擊單元格(紅點) - 上下文菜單顯示.. 但錯誤的地方。 不明白爲什麼 這裏是代碼:上下文菜單錯誤出現位置
ContextMenu m = new ContextMenu();
m.Show(ServersTable, new Point(Cursor.Position.X, Cursor.Position.Y));
的東西真的惹惱了我!
只是翻譯點到網格:[?我該怎麼辦時,有人回答我的問題]
m.Show(ServersTable, ServersTable.PointToClient(
new Point(Cursor.Position.X, Cursor.Position.Y)));
上帝保佑你這個人!我會在這個週末爲你喝酒! –
@ Greag.Deay,我很高興我可以幫助! –
@ Greag.Deay,將此標記爲正確答案:) –
(http://meta.stackoverflow.com/help/someone-answers) – paqogomez